CI note: the Mergewell dedup pipeline tests fail intermittently on the customer-record matching stage. Cause: fixture records load in nondeterministic order, so fuzzy-match scores differ between runs. Not a product bug — no customer data is affected, so do not escalate tickets citing this. Workaround: rerun the job once; fix (sorted fixtures) lands this week. Reference the failing run via the trace token below.

pipeline stamp: htk3_69f

### Step 6: Import service credentials — Grainfall CSV Wizard

The wizard's import worker validates uploaded CSVs in an isolated container. The container has no network access except to the schema registry, which requires authentication. Permissions on the env file should be 0600, owned by the service account, and the file must not be committed to the config repo. With those checks confirmed, add the registry secret to the env file on the line below.

vault entry, bagag-yahap: COURIER_KEY8=5927b6fa

**Mgmt Meeting Minutes — Retiring the Brightline Range**

Quick recap for sales leads at Fenholt Supplies: we agreed to retire the Brightline fixture range by year-end. Remaining stock moves to clearance pricing next month, and accounts on standing orders get migrated to the Lumetta range. Trade-in incentives were approved in principle. The confidential note on next steps sits just below.

board note of bajof-bajeg: The pricing group signed off on a budget of $13.4 million for Project Sildor. The renewal with Lamixek Holdings closes at $48.9 million a year, 49 percent above the last contract.

Subject: Quickstore 4.2 — bloom filter now fronts the KV layer

Plugin authors: starting with this release, Quickstore places a bloom filter ahead of the key-value store. Negative lookups return faster; false positives fall through safely. No API changes are required on your side. Verify your plugin against the staging build referenced below.

session token of fahif-tadup = htk3_9c7